Output 22b91b89b229e914de004bc841af1e362ffcf67dfd6de294263fd50901aa4f58:7

value
38000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23b291a8ae9080ca35bf5b5f0c7fa8eab4b7294 OP_EQUAL
address
3KQ1tJk3Gvy7bJ78aeXfZrcBjeoxTMQJmn
transaction
22b91b89b229e914de004bc841af1e362ffcf67dfd6de294263fd50901aa4f58
confirmations
496319
spent
true